Delphi-PRAXiS

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   Win32/Win64 API (native code) (https://www.delphipraxis.net/17-win32-win64-api-native-code/)
-   -   Delphi Pointeradressen aus einer Text Datei auslesen? (https://www.delphipraxis.net/121574-pointeradressen-aus-einer-text-datei-auslesen.html)

Seren200018 30. Sep 2008 17:15


Pointeradressen aus einer Text Datei auslesen?
 
Der Titel sagt alles.
Ich möchte aus einer Textdatei folgenden Formats

Zitat:

[Address]
Name=78CA64
BaseLv=78BA28
JobLv=78BA34
Exp=78BA24
ExpNext=78BA30
Job=78BAE0
JobNext=78BADC
JobCls=78BA20
ok=ok
die Pointeradressen auf die Speicherbereiche auslesen und nutzen. Leider habe ich keine Ahnung wie ich das nun anstellen soll.
Das Auslesen klappt bereits mit festem Pointer das Problem ist das sich das Programm möglichen Veränderungen anpassen soll.

Edit:
Ach ja ich wollte eigentlich das Speicherauslesen ganz umgehen und statt dessen lieber die Packets vom Server abfangen und auswerten.
Ich habe allerdings noch nie mit einem Packet sniffer gearbeitet.

Um die legalität des ganzen müsst ihr euch keine Sorgen machen. Ich habe bereits mit den Verantwortlichen gesprochen die hatten erst mal nichts dagegen solange ich von ihnen das Programm vor der Veröffentlichung überprüfen und komplilieren lasse.

Apollonius 30. Sep 2008 17:18

Re: Pointeradressen aus einer Text Datei auslesen?
 
In .NET solltest du keine Zeiger verwenden.
Deine Textdatei ist eine Ini-Datei. Du kannst mit TIniFile die Werte auslesen, jeweils ein $ voranstellen und den entstandenen String an StrToInt übergeben. Die zurückgegebene Zahl kannst du dann casten.

Seren200018 30. Sep 2008 17:26

Re: Pointeradressen aus einer Text Datei auslesen?
 
Ups da hatte ich mich verklickt ich benutze Delphi Win32


Alle Zeitangaben in WEZ +1. Es ist jetzt 21:21 Uhr.

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z